Roku Express 4K streaming stick supports AirPlay 2 and HDR10+ – and is cheap – What Hi-Fi?
The new budget Roku streamer could give the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K a run for its money

Want to stream your favourite movies and TV shows in 4K without breaking the bank? Roku’s new entry-level 4K streamer could be just the ticket. The Roku Express 4K streaming stick (£40, $40) supports AirPlay 2 a feature that was previously only on the companys more expensive 4K devices and, a first for Roku players, HDR10+.
